Description
The dramatic theft of an 18th century painting is discovered just moments before the old manor house from which it was stolen is set on fire. Making matters more grisly is the pile of bones sighted in the blazing inferno moments before the roof collapses. What started as simple, if surprising, theft has quickly escalated to arson and, possibly murder, and now Detective Inspector Sloan and Detective Constable Crosby have to piece together, a puzzle which has its roots deep in Berebury's history.--from Publisher's description.
